機(jī)器視覺(jué)系統(tǒng)的跨平臺(tái)適配與集成培訓(xùn)是實(shí)現(xiàn)不同硬件和軟件環(huán)境之間互通的關(guān)鍵,本文將從多個(gè)方面探討如何有效進(jìn)行這一過(guò)程,以提高系統(tǒng)的靈活性和應(yīng)用廣泛性。

理解跨平臺(tái)適配的挑戰(zhàn)

機(jī)器視覺(jué)系統(tǒng)在不同平臺(tái)上的部署面臨諸多挑戰(zhàn),包括硬件設(shè)備的差異、操作系統(tǒng)的不同、數(shù)據(jù)格式的兼容性等。開(kāi)發(fā)人員需要深入理解每個(gè)目標(biāo)平臺(tái)的特性和限制,以制定適當(dāng)?shù)倪m配策略。例如,某些平臺(tái)可能對(duì)處理器架構(gòu)有特定要求,而另一些可能依賴(lài)特定的圖像處理庫(kù)或編程語(yǔ)言。

跨平臺(tái)適配的技術(shù)手段

軟件抽象層(Software Abstraction Layer)

軟件抽象層是一種常見(jiàn)的技術(shù)手段,通過(guò)在不同平臺(tái)之間建立統(tǒng)一的接口和數(shù)據(jù)格式,實(shí)現(xiàn)軟件的跨平臺(tái)兼容性。這種方法能夠有效地隔離底層硬件的差異,提供統(tǒng)一的編程接口,使開(kāi)發(fā)人員能夠?qū)W⒂诠δ軐?shí)現(xiàn)而非平臺(tái)特定的細(xì)節(jié)。

虛擬化技術(shù)

如何進(jìn)行機(jī)器視覺(jué)系統(tǒng)的跨平臺(tái)適配與集成培訓(xùn)

虛擬化技術(shù)通過(guò)在不同硬件和操作系統(tǒng)上創(chuàng)建虛擬環(huán)境,實(shí)現(xiàn)原本無(wú)法直接兼容的軟件的運(yùn)行。例如,通過(guò)虛擬機(jī)或容器技術(shù),可以在統(tǒng)一的虛擬環(huán)境中運(yùn)行機(jī)器視覺(jué)應(yīng)用程序,從而簡(jiǎn)化跨平臺(tái)部署和管理。

跨平臺(tái)集成培訓(xùn)的重要性

統(tǒng)一標(biāo)準(zhǔn)和流程

在機(jī)器視覺(jué)系統(tǒng)的跨平臺(tái)適配過(guò)程中,培訓(xùn)關(guān)鍵技術(shù)人員是確保成功的關(guān)鍵。通過(guò)為團(tuán)隊(duì)提供統(tǒng)一的標(biāo)準(zhǔn)和流程培訓(xùn),能夠提高團(tuán)隊(duì)協(xié)作效率和項(xiàng)目執(zhí)行質(zhì)量。培訓(xùn)內(nèi)容應(yīng)包括不同平臺(tái)的特性和適配策略,以及相關(guān)的調(diào)試和優(yōu)化技巧。

實(shí)際案例和實(shí)驗(yàn)

培訓(xùn)過(guò)程中,結(jié)合實(shí)際案例和實(shí)驗(yàn)是非常有效的方法。通過(guò)模擬真實(shí)場(chǎng)景和問(wèn)題,讓參與者親自動(dòng)手解決跨平臺(tái)適配中可能遇到的挑戰(zhàn)和難點(diǎn),從而增強(qiáng)其技能和信心。

機(jī)器視覺(jué)系統(tǒng)的跨平臺(tái)適配與集成培訓(xùn)不僅是技術(shù)人員必備的能力,也是企業(yè)提升競(jìng)爭(zhēng)力和擴(kuò)展市場(chǎng)的重要策略。未來(lái),隨著技術(shù)的不斷進(jìn)步和應(yīng)用場(chǎng)景的擴(kuò)展,跨平臺(tái)適配的需求將繼續(xù)增長(zhǎng)。建議未來(lái)的研究可以關(guān)注于更智能化和自動(dòng)化的適配方法,以應(yīng)對(duì)復(fù)雜多變的市場(chǎng)需求。

希望讀者能夠更深入地理解如何有效進(jìn)行機(jī)器視覺(jué)系統(tǒng)的跨平臺(tái)適配與集成培訓(xùn),從而在實(shí)際應(yīng)用中取得更好的效果和成就。